Eurocement’s Lipetskcement has completed its maintenance campaign, which took place from November 2014 to May 2015. During this time, the packaging line, which had run uninterrupted since its installation in 2007, was upgraded and kiln 3 was refurbished. Cement mills 6 – 8 were also repaired and new separators installed. A new portable XRF analyser from Bruker was also commissioned.
The repairs have been completed in time for the peak construction season, when the plant typically runs at full capacity.
Eurocement has been carrying out a programme of upgrade and modernisation projects across its plants. Most recently, Mordovcement has completed a reconstruction project on two lines that increases efficiency and throughput.
